Oh my god! I think it will be a long time for me to come to Fosters for a meal again.
When ordering, we were told that the soup of the day is pumpkin soup. But after that, we were told it has been changed to cream of chicken. When the soup come, it was very white. Can only taste of milk/cream. Perhaps it is because it come with the set lunch(Prices:S$12.90 ~ $15.90+++), so cannot complain too much.
Also order caesar salad with chicken and deep fried calamari. The calamari not hot but still OK. The chicken in caesar salad was dry and hard. Had hard time chewing. And they did not give plates for us to share the starters.
Order Tenderloin Minute Steak with mushroom and onion sauce. Remember that I order mid well done so I will not see the blood. But I cut, blood flow out. Those also ordered this said is just OK that's all. There's better nearby.
About 5 of us ordered Emince of Chicken (Sauteed slice Chicken fillet with fresh mushroom sauce). All complained that it was too tasteless and hard. None were able to finish it.
For those who ordered Pan Seared Fish Fillet. It is a rather big potion. But it is actually fish in batter. Not pan seared. Felt like been conned.
As for the oxtail stew, it seems those who had it has no complain. Presentation for that dish has improved a lot since my last visit in March I think.
Lastly for dessert, we have black sesame pudding. Sound weird for an English place. Very sweet and milky. Could barely taste the tea we had afterwards. And they didn't refill my ice water.
